The committee also received a demonstration of the PNGV Home Page on the World Wide Web and was provided with written status reports by the PNGV on activities relating to Goals 1 and 2.
On August 27, 1995, selected members of the committee and NRC staff received an overview of the PNGV program from representatives of USCAR and the U.S. government.
A review of Ford Concept Vehicle activities was provided to the full committee by Chuck Risch of Ford Motor Company on August 29, 1995.
